Add a payment method
Credit Card
- In the main menu, select Wallet.
- Select Add New > Card.
- Enter your card or account details.
- Select Add Card.
- You may be prompted here to enter a one time password that will be either sent to your card's mobile application or your phone itself via SMS, if so, enter the passcode, and click Confirm
- Your credit card is now added, and you can start making payments.
Bank Account
Follow the below steps if you would like us to direct debit your bank account for payments processed through pay.com.au. If you will be using PayID, you do not need to link your bank account to your Wallet. More information on PayID can be viewed here.
- In the main menu, select Wallet.
- Select Add and choose a payment method: Bank Account.
- Follow the on-screen prompts to add your bank account using Basiq, our open banking software provider. For more information on Basiq, click here.
- Define a transaction limit (This step only applies if you are using Same-day payments with PayTo)
- Your transaction limit must be less than your daily limit on your bank account. Contact your bank to find out your daily limit.
- This limit will become the transaction limit. You will be able to make unlimited payments, as long as each individual payment is under this transaction limit.
- This limit will only be applicable if your account is PayTo enabled.
- For information about availability of PayTo, please refer to this link: PayTo Bank Availability
-
Select Continue:
a) If an account is PayTo enabled, you will see instructions about how to accept the agreement in your banking application.b) If an account is not PayTo enabled, you will be able to add your bank account by following the instructions and connecting to Basiq. - On success, the account will appear in the PayWallet.
IMPORTANT: Please check card or account information is correct. pay.com.au is not liable for losses if incorrect information is entered.
Delete a payment method
- In the main menu, select Wallet.
- Select the kebab (3 dots) menu on the payment method you wish to delete.
- Select Delete > Confirm Delete.
